]> git.pld-linux.org Git - packages/wavpack.git/blob - wavpack.spec
2ffb8e7895a62604a49e5448cf84084bdefcb453
[packages/wavpack.git] / wavpack.spec
1 Summary:        Open audio compression codec
2 Summary(pl.UTF-8):      Otwarty kodek kompresji dźwięku
3 Name:           wavpack
4 Version:        4.41.0
5 Release:        1
6 License:        other
7 Group:          Libraries
8 Source0:        http://www.wavpack.com/%{name}-%{version}.tar.bz2
9 # Source0-md5:  6a13edeae437498db78fe528d9e95144
10 URL:            http://www.wavpack.com/
11 BuildRequires:  autoconf
12 BuildRequires:  automake
13 BuildRequires:  libtool
14 Requires:       %{name}-libs = %{version}-%{release}
15 BuildRoot:      %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
16
17 %description
18 WavPack is a completely open audio compression format providing
19 lossless, high-quality lossy, and a unique hybrid compression mode.
20
21 Although the technology is loosely based on previous versions of
22 WavPack, the new version 4 format has been designed from the ground up
23 to offer unparalleled performance and functionality. In the default
24 lossless mode WavPack acts just like a WinZip compressor for audio
25 files. However, unlike MP3 or WMA encoding which can affect the sound
26 quality, not a single bit of the original information is lost, so
27 there's no chance of degradation. This makes lossless mode ideal for
28 archiving audio material or any other situation where quality is
29 paramount. The compression ratio depends on the source material, but
30 generally is between 30% and 70%.
31
32 The hybrid mode provides all the advantages of lossless compression
33 with an additional bonus. Instead of creating a single file, this mode
34 creates both a relatively small, high-quality lossy file that can be
35 used all by itself, and a "correction" file that (when combined with
36 the lossy file) provides full lossless restoration. For some users
37 this means never having to choose between lossless and lossy
38 compression!
39
40 %description -l pl.UTF-8
41 WavPack to całkowicie otwarty format kompresji dźwięku dostarczający
42 tryby kompresji: bezstratny, stratny wysokiej jakości oraz unikalny
43 hybrydowy.
44
45 Chociaż technologia jest luźno oparta na poprzednich wersjach
46 WavPacka, format nowej wersji 4 został zaprojektowany od nowa, aby
47 zaoferować niezrównaną wydajność i funkcjonalność. W domyślnym trybie
48 bezstratnym WavPack zachowuje się tak jak kompresor WinZip dla plików
49 dźwiękowych. Jednak w przeciwieństwie do kodowań MP3 czy WMA, które
50 wpływają na jakość dźwięku, żaden bit oryginalnej informacji nie jest
51 tracony, więc nie ma żadnych szans na degradację. Czyni to tryb
52 bezstratny idealnym do archiwizowania materiałów dźwiękowych oraz w
53 innych sytuacjach, gdzie jakość jest najważniejsza. Współczynnik
54 kompresji zależy od materiału źródłowego, ale zwykle jest pomiędzy
55 30% a 70%.
56
57 Tryb hybrydowy udostępnia wszystkie zalety kompresji bezstratnej z
58 dodatkowym ulepszeniem. Zamiast tworzenia pojedynczego pliku tryb ten
59 tworzy zarówno stosunkowo mały, wysokiej jakości plik stratny, który
60 może być używany jako taki oraz plik "poprawek", który (w połączeniu z
61 plikiem stratnym) odtwarza pełną jakość bez strat. Dla niektórych
62 użytkowników oznacza to, że nie muszą wybierać pomiędzy kompresją
63 bezstratną a stratną.
64
65 %package libs
66 Summary:        Wavpack library
67 Summary(pl.UTF-8):      Biblioteka Wavpack
68 Group:          Libraries
69 Requires:       %{name}-libs = %{version}-%{release}
70
71 %description libs
72 Wavpack library.
73
74 %description libs -l pl.UTF-8
75 Biblioteka Wavpack.
76
77 %package devel
78 Summary:        Header files for Wavpack
79 Summary(pl.UTF-8):      Pliki nagłówkowe Wavpack
80 Group:          Development/Libraries
81 Requires:       %{name}-libs = %{version}-%{release}
82
83 %description devel
84 Header files for Wavpack.
85
86 %description devel -l pl.UTF-8
87 Pliki nagłówkowe biblioteki Wavpack.
88
89 %package static
90 Summary:        Static Wavpack library
91 Summary(pl.UTF-8):      Statyczna biblioteka Wavpack
92 Group:          Development/Libraries
93 Requires:       %{name}-devel = %{version}-%{release}
94
95 %description static
96 Static Wavpack library.
97
98 %description static -l pl.UTF-8
99 Statyczna biblioteka Wavpack.
100
101 %prep
102 %setup -q
103
104 %build
105 %{__libtoolize}
106 %{__aclocal}
107 %{__autoconf}
108 %{__automake}
109 %configure
110 %{__make}
111
112 %install
113 rm -rf $RPM_BUILD_ROOT
114
115 %{__make} install \
116         DESTDIR=$RPM_BUILD_ROOT
117
118 %clean
119 rm -rf $RPM_BUILD_ROOT
120
121 %post   libs -p /sbin/ldconfig
122 %postun libs -p /sbin/ldconfig
123
124 %files
125 %defattr(644,root,root,755)
126 %doc ChangeLog README license.txt
127 %attr(755,root,root) %{_bindir}/*
128
129 %files libs
130 %defattr(644,root,root,755)
131 %attr(755,root,root) %{_libdir}/lib*.so.*.*.*
132
133 %files devel
134 %defattr(644,root,root,755)
135 %attr(755,root,root) %{_libdir}/lib*.so
136 %{_libdir}/lib*.la
137 %{_includedir}/wavpack
138 %{_pkgconfigdir}/*.pc
139
140 %files static
141 %defattr(644,root,root,755)
142 %{_libdir}/lib*.a
This page took 0.039228 seconds and 2 git commands to generate.